Photo - Connector at DME, can I remove cover



In order to access pins on the connector while it is connected to the DME unit, can I remove the cover off the white connector ?

The purpose is to examine with a multimeter if the DME unit is getting correct signals - with harness connected to DME.

Yes you can remove it.

There is a small Phillips head screw on the top (curved area). Unscrew that.

Then on the bottom there is a rubber sleeve, likely held with a zip tie, cut the zip tie.

Roll the sleeve down, then slide the white curved portion up. It should slide up pretty easily. It's a two part contraption.

There is a retaining clip that slides into the connector from one side.

Sometimes the retaining clip and rubber seal will fall out.. you want to make sure those stay on during re-installation or the connections will be loose.

Install is the reverse and add a new zip tie to clean things up.
